You can hide your spare key on your dog. In order to make this work, your dog either needs to stay outside or have access to a pet door. Store a spare key within your dogs collar so you always have access to your home.

Look for ways to make your home seem occupied. You could purchase timers which make lights and TV’s, as well as other devices, power on or off at varying intervals. In this way, it will always seem that someone is in your home. This helps you keep your house burglar-free.

Home security systems have additional features to just being noise alarms. Many systems can alert you whenever anyone has entered your home. This could be valuable for parents who have small children, making them aware when their kid has closed or opened a door.

It is a good idea to replace all the locks on the new home you buy. There is no way to ascertain how many keys the previous owner handed out. Having a locksmith replace the locks will ensure that no strangers have a key. Also, if you ever lose your keys, do the same.

You should invest in fire-resistant roofing, flooring and ceiling. Having your home built with fire resistant materials will help safeguard your home in case it catches fire. It’s best to prevent a fire before it starts.

Use a safe to protect your valuables. This will keep your stash of diamonds, gold and other valuable items out of view and inaccessible to burglars. Keep your safe in a hard-to-get-to place, such as a basement closet or your attic.

In the summertime, you should rid your yard of dead bushes and vegetation. Due to the heat, these items in your yard are more likely to catch on fire. As a result, your home could be caught on fire. Keep your yard clear so it is a safe area.

Seek recommendations from friends and family when choosing a security company or system. Your loved ones likely have dealt with this situation before. Ask a number of people to get a several different opinions.

Keep your car in the garage. Keeping the car in the garage can keep thieves from vandalizing or stealing it. If you keep your car in the garage instead of in the driveway, it is harder for thieves to know whether you are at home or not.

When you’re going away, turn off your phone ringers. If your phone is ringing while you are out, burglars will realize that no one is home, making your home very vulnerable to an attack during your time away.

You should not hide your spare key under your mat or inside a plant box. You are allowing people to invade your home when you make it easy for them. Intruders know about the usual hiding spots. Instead, give your extra key to a neighbor whom you trust.

Never allow any strangers into your home. Even if the person has a compelling story, needs help or has something to sell, they should not be given access. This is the first rule of keeping your home secure.

Be sure your expensive belongings are not visible from the home’s exterior. Though it is nice to have big windows to get a great view of the outdoors, it is also easier for burglars to look into your home. If you’ve got street facing windows, be sure and keep them covered.

Never open up your door to a stranger. People try many ways to convince others to open up their doors so that they can commit burglary or worse. Make it mandatory that doors in your home are only opened for expected visitors.

If you are moving in your new home, ensure all the old locks are replaced. It may seem as if the former owners of the home are honest, but really you don’t know much about them. Keep in mind that other people may have lived in the home prior to the seller.

Secure your attached garage. Intruders can enter your home through an unlocked garage door. However, you can use a C-clamp to help keep the door secure.

If your home isn’t new, replace the locks. The previous tenant or owner may not have the keys, but you don’t know if they made copies for themselves or others. You can change the locks yourself if you’re feeling really industrious.

If you live in a rural area, you may not be as concerned about home break-ins as people who live in the city. Some people think that the people out in the country without neighbors are actually at a much greater risk. Others hold that burglars are not as likely to target rural areas.

If you are searching for ways to make your home more secure, one inexpensive way to accomplish this is to purchase exterior lights that have motion detectors. In the evening, lights will help keep your home safe, and will add little in the way of extra expense. Properly-situated motion detectors will give your home a complete field of protection and make it impossible for a miscreant to approach undetected.

Don’t forget about the skylights when securing your home. Skylights are excellent for beauty and light, but it’s easy for burglars to gain access to your home through them. The hardware that secures your skylights should be sturdy and durable.

You can find an excellent home security company with a simple Internet search. Check out reviews you find on the web. Make appointments with the three best companies, and take the time to go over the details and compare them.

Keep valuables hidden within the walls. This does not mean that you should make alterations to your walls. Many places around your house have areas that are already pre-cut. Perhaps you could deactivate a few unused electrical sockets to use as a place to store stuff.

An important part of vetting any security company before you sign a contract with them is finding out how long they’ve been providing security services in your community. Find a home security company that has a good reputation and many years of experience to get excellent service. It can ease your mind when you know you’re not doing business with a company that might not be around tomorrow.

Even if you’re not going to be gone long, keep your home locked. Most real-world burglars aren’t master lock-breakers; they simply stroll in through a door left carelessly unlocked. Thieves can steal thousands worth of your belongings very quickly.

You need to think about what you need as far as home security before you look at different systems. Though such systems can be terrific for many, not everyone really needs one. Some individuals are more comfortable with a canine alarm, while other people enjoy the feeling of security that a sophisticated alarm system can bring. Know what you want and make your decisions based on that.

When you pick an alarm system, it’s a good idea to get one that provides protection for both doors and windows. Windows need to be monitored too. You want a security system that monitors all your windows and doors. With this method, your family will be safer.

Ask the company if they offer systems for lease and sale. You’ll spend less money in the long-run if you buy the equipment outright. Although leasing is usually cheaper, you may have to fill out contracts and you will have higher monthly costs. Find out which will work best for your needs.

Replace all the locks in your newly purchased home. Although the person you purchased the house from might seem good, you really have no clue as to who they really are. Many other people could have keys to the property, and you probably don’t want them to all have access to your home.

If you have a numeric keypad on your door as your lock, don’t make the password your birthday. Your birth date is pretty easy to come by, especially for seasoned thieves. Try making the number one that can be remembered by doing a match equation in order to remember that equation instead.

Keep flashlights in your rooms. Flashlights are very important, as they will give you the ability to move around in the event of an emergency. Your kids should know how to work the flashlights so that everyone can help.

Think about a security system that is hard-wired if you really have concerns about maintenance costs. While wireless systems are great, they do require batteries on a consistent basis. You might forget to change out the batteries, which will result in your system not operating as it should. Also, having to replace batteries on a regular basis can quickly become costly.

The number one thing you must do if you’re moving into a new place is have the locks changed. The previous owners or tenants might have made some copies of the key. Find a reliable locksmith who can replace the locks or do it yourself.

Always keep your irreplaceable valuables secure. It is best to keep items such as passports, legal documents, photos and financial records in a spot that is secure. A great choice for keeping these items in your home is a floor safe. A better idea could be to store these inside a box outside of your house.

Do your landscaping keeping safety in mind. Don’t obstruct windows or doors with shrubs, plants, fences or trees. If they can be seen, people will not hide there and attempt a break-in. Plan your home with safety in mind.

Replace your doors with some that are solid wood or metal. Doors made of metal or wood are much sturdier than those that aren’t. A burglar is very unlikely to be able to kick in a solid wood or metal door. Replacing doors is not very expensive and should make a real difference.
